Astoria Wa. is a nice place to visit. We stayed at the Red Lion, it was a reasonable price with a nice view. If you are feeling up to it, you can climb the stairs at the big lookout tower thats there. There will be all sorts of campgrounds open that time of year. Sounds like a fun trip. Enjoy.

Central Coast Wine Country has some of the best motorcycle roads around. State 154 takes you through the San Marcos Pass into central coast wine country if that interests you. It's a great ride too - not as spectacular as rt 1 Monterey and Big Sur but fun none the less ; and if you like grapes its a nice destination with a lower price tag then Napa.
